Cellulose from Softwood via Prehydrolysis and Soda/Anthraquinone Pulping
Journal of Wood Chemistry and Technology, 1997Abstract A two stage process based on a hydrolytic pretreatment and a soda/anthraquinone pulping stage has been studied to produce bleachable-grade cellulose from residual softwood sawdust, concretely a mixture of ground spruce (Abies alba) and pine (Pinus insignis).

Acid prehydrolysis of pinus pinaster bark with dilute sulfuric acid
Wood Science and Technology, 1988The influence of temperature (100–150°C) and acid concentration (0–5 wt%) on the prehydrolysis of pine bark and its alkaline-extracted residues was studied (the latter were obtained by vigorously stirring the bark for 15 min with a solid/liquid ratio of 1:10).

Prehydrolysis ofEucalyptus wood with dilute sulphuric acid: operation in autoclave
Holz als Roh- und Werkstoff, 1994The production of xylose fromEucalyptus globulus wood samples in media containing sulphuric acid was studied. The prehydrolysis reactions were carried out in autoclave. All the experiments were performed with liquid/wood ratio of 10 g/g. The effects of sulphuric acid concentration (within the range 2–6%), reaction time (0–6 h) and temperature (115 or ...
